Output 454cbae7ac77a8f20785e9405233e3d98fd14c52aa48ad79d1b5d43709688bfc:0

value
18523083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b13f7041f12e3774a69b511e3b22363e322eaac OP_EQUAL
address
MEk8q1A2sVvzw4rTVwbs1jACKpAErmo11M
transaction
454cbae7ac77a8f20785e9405233e3d98fd14c52aa48ad79d1b5d43709688bfc
spent
true